Which of the following is not generally a reason why humans create boundaries? A. territoriality

B. protection and security

C. increased access to an area

D. safety

The correct answer is C. increased access to an area.

Explanation: Humans create boundaries primarily for reasons such as territoriality, protection and security, and safety. These boundaries help define personal or group spaces, establish control, and ensure safety from external threats. However, “increased access to an area” does not align with the typical motivations for creating boundaries, as boundaries often restrict access rather than promote it.
